Description

This program is specifically designed for upper elementary students (grades 4-5) to build the critical cognitive skills necessary for a successful transition to middle school. The core curriculum focuses on five key domains: planning, prioritization, organization, task initiation, and fundamental study skills. Students will engage in 8 weeks of hands-on activities designed as “escape room” challenges to master executive functioning skills. Each session, students leave with a tangible tool to assist with their continued execution of the strategies they practice in session.
